The Daily Dispatch, Volume 12, Number 79, 30 September 1857
STRAYED—From my house, on l* l6 Darbytown Road, 9 miles froin - XLJL Richmond, on the 12th of September, two Cows—one is a red and white Cow. with a very small brass bell and a pine yoke: and the other is a large Cow, with white and brindle spots, and a small bell round the neck. Also, strayed about the middle of July, a black COW, with a white spot in the face, and white under the ears, and half of her tail white. A liberal reward will be paid for any of the abore Cows, if delivered tome, as above. ge 30—It* SAMUEL WHITLOW.

1860 Henrico Co., (Eastern Region) VA: Samuel Whitloe enumerated next to “Mathew” Whitlow (believed to be Nathaniel Whitlow) and Nancy Whitlow (mother of Nathaniel)
**Could Samuel be a younger brother of Mathew/Nathaniel?
